IMO, no.

The various images will not attempt to communicate with each other in Monoplex 
mode.

The CTC's should be defined and then run GRS in RING mode.
As I previously posted, the more systems to be communicated with in the longer 
GRS will take to respond.
This escalates very rapidly.

  CF or CF engine is not required.

To complement:
Parallel Sysplex - a CF is required, which mean sysplex links
(emulated, free - for PS within single CPC). GRS is STAR mode is
possible and strongly suggested. (GRSplex is required, the mode is suggested).

Base Sysplex - CTC links required. In the old days also sysplex timer.
Now it can be sysplex link to provide time synchronization for STP
(Server Time Protocol). The GRS is mandatory and it's configuration
is RING, which is not the best from performance point of view. For
base sysplex within single CPC there are no STP-only links, but CTC
over FICON is required. Note: the FICON can be shared, that means
used for other purposes.

Monoplex. GRSplex is still possible (unless something changed) and it
is RING topology with drawbacks mentioned above. Of course multiple
monoplex LPARs may share DASD without GRSplex, but again it is not
seamless - at least PDSE sharing is almost impossible.

You can just use extra FICON interfaces as FCTC's.  IBM refers to that method 
as a baby sysplex.  It allows you to have GRS in ring mode.  TO have star mode 
you need CF's.

If you have multiple LPARs and you share dasd, then you need either CF's 
(expensive) or Ficon CTCs (pretty cheap).  The setup is very simple.  CF's are 
much faster but ficon CTC's easily handle 3,4 or 5 lpars without any issues at 
all.
